Disposal
2
Packaging material
The packaging materials are environmentally
friendly and can be recycled. The plastic com-
ponents are identified by markings, e.g. >PE<,
>PS<, etc. Please dispose of the packaging
materials in the appropriate container at the
community waste disposal facilities.
2 Old appliance
Please dispose of your old appliance in line
with the guidelines for disposal in your com-
munity.
1 Warning! When your appliance has finished
its working life, remove the plug from the
socket. Cut off the cable and plug and dispose
of them.
Break the door lock so that the door no longer
shuts. This prevents children from trapping
themselves inside and endangering their lives.
Technical data
5
This appliance conforms with the following EU
Directives:
73/23/EEC dated 19.02.1973 Low Voltage Direc-
tive
89/336/EEC dated 03.05.1989 EMC Directive in-
clusive of Amending Directive 92/31/EEC
93/68/EEC dated 22.07.1993 CE Marking Directive
Capacity: 12 place settings including serving dishes
Permitted water pressure: 1-10 bar (=10-100 N/cm
2
= 0.1-1.0 MPa)
Electrical connection:
Information on the electrical connection is given on the rating plate located
on the right inner edge of the dishwasher door.
Dishwasher: Free-standing appliances
Dimensions: 850 x 598 x 598 (H x W x D in mm)
Max. weight: 54 kg
